Police officer, one other injured in Bluffton Parkway crash on Monday, officials say

Traffic cameras at Bluffton Parkway and Buck Island Road show traffic following a crash that shut down all eastbound lanes of Bluffton Parkway Monday afternoon.

Two people, including a Bluffton Police Department officer, were taken to the hospital after a crash Monday afternoon on Bluffton Parkway, according to the South Carolina Highway Patrol.

The crash happened at 1:10 p.m. at Bluffton Parkway and Buck Island Road, said Trooper Nick Pye with the South Carolina Highway Patrol. The two cars involved in the crash included a 2021 Ford Explorer registered to the Bluffton Police Department and a 2007 Nissan pickup truck.

Pye did not know the condition either driver was in following the crash.

The crash shut down all eastbound traffic in Bluffton Parkway until about 1:45 p.m., according to a Beaufort County Sheriff’s Office alert and the Bluffton Township Fire District.

The crash involved an officer and will be investigated by the South Carolina Highway Patrol, said Sgt. Bonifacio Perez with the Bluffton Police Department.
